Pin code 756126 belongs to Baleswar district in Odisha, India. This pin code is served by 12 post offices, with Anandapur (Branch Office) as the primary office. It falls under the Bhubaneswar HQ postal region, Bhadrak division, and Odisha postal circle. The taluk covered is Similia.

What Does Pin Code 756126 Mean?

Every Indian PIN code is a 6-digit number where each digit carries a specific meaning. Here's how 756126 breaks down:

Digit Position Value What It Represents
1st digit — Postal Zone 7 Eastern region of India
2nd digit — Sub-zone 5 Sub-region within Odisha
3rd digit — Sorting District 6 Bhadrak sorting district
Last 3 digits — Post Office 126 Anandapur (B.O)

The first digit 7 places this pincode in the Eastern postal zone. The combination 75 narrows it to a sub-region within Odisha, while 756 identifies the Bhadrak sorting district. The final three digits 126 point to the specific delivery post office — Anandapur.
